  6. Area codes 570 and 272 -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Area_codes_570_and_272

    Area code 717 was assigned to the eastern half of Pennsylvania, excluding the Delaware and Lehigh Valleys. Area code 570 was created when the 717 numbering plan area was divided on December 5, 1998. It was the first new Pennsylvania area code created outside Philadelphia and Pittsburgh since the implementation of the area code system.

  7. Area codes 215, 267, and 445 -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Area_codes_215,_267,_and_445

    Area code 445 was first proposed in July 2000 as an overlay code on numbering plan area 215/267. [1] However, these plans were delayed and then rescinded in 2003 by the Pennsylvania Public Utility Commission. [2] The need for new phone numbers in area codes 215/267 was delayed until 2018.

  9. Area codes 513 and 283 -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Area_codes_513_and_283

    In 2000, area code 283 was reserved as an overlay code for numbering plan area 513. Although permissive dialing began on January 15, 2001, the implementation was suspended, because of the economic downturn and the return of telephone numbers as a result of the abandonment of service by competitive local telephone companies.
